To the north of Ginnungagap it was bitterly cold. (20) Nothing was there but fields of snow and mountains made of ice. To the south of Ginnungagap was a region where frost and snow were never seen. It was always bright, and was the home of light and heat. The sunshine from the South melted the ice mountains of the North so that they toppled over and fell into Ginnungagap.
